In 2001, the Child Protection in Sport Unit (CPSU) was funded to help sports organisations implement the 2000 National Action Plan for Child Protection in Sport. It is a partnership between the NSPCC, Sport England, SportScotland, Sports Council for Northern Ireland and the Sports Council for Wales.
The CPSU's mission is to safeguard the welfare of children and young people under 18 in sport and to promote their well-being.
